IP查询
查询
你查询的IP:[60.55.26.139] 地理位置:中国–浙江
最新查询
117.106.0.90
58.14.251.96
219.82.46.50
122.64.170.197
116.60.179.6
116.1.207.17
114.54.93.38
124.29.104.7
122.96.45.84
60.55.26.139
119.128.240.194
118.132.190.67
124.88.35.189
222.168.126.98
202.173.8.49
117.60.165.149
202.120.36.112
122.8.87.96
202.93.214.114
116.204.0.202
203.81.16.101
116.194.74.12
61.232.208.53
58.100.174.138
118.126.78.151
202.96.92.8
116.193.16.171
124.156.86.86
119.20.183.47
118.80.157.107
202.38.149.129